Who we are

Everything is changing in how software gets built, and Sourcegraph is at the center of that transformation. With Code Search, Deep Search, and MCP, Sourcegraph is the world’s most powerful code intelligence platform that developers and agents rely on to navigate, understand, and operate on massive, complex codebases with speed and confidence.

Teams at companies like Stripe, Uber, and Dropbox rely on Sourcegraph to ship faster and with higher quality. We’re backed by a16z, Sequoia, and Redpoint, and proud to operate as a globally distributed team that values high agency, direct communication, and a deep love for developers and their craft.

Why this job is exciting

As part of the Technical Success organization, Support Engineering  is at the forefront of the customer experience. Our customers simply wouldn’t be successful, happy, long term customers without the important work this team does! Support Engineering exists to not only resolve technical issues but educate our customers by answering reactive questions, and by importantly identifying improvements we can make to help improve the product. Our customers are developers and we help them throughout their customer journey. 

📅 Within one month you will…

  • Learn about our product, our value propositions, our customers, our team, and our practices.
  • Learn how Sourcegraph is deployed (e.g., Kubernetes, scaling, and more), product configuration and integrations, our code base, and common user needs.
  • Meet for an initial chat with the teammates you will work with most
  • Start working with customers to troubleshoot and solve reported issues (with lots of support and help from your team).

📅 Within three months you will…

  • Work with customers to troubleshoot and solve reported issues
  • Contribute to improving our product and handbook documentation

📅 Within six months you will…

  • Observe trends causing issues for our customers and suggest remedies (for example, what consistent things happen that we can write tooling for...)
  • Suggest (and take responsibility for) improvements for team onboarding and ongoing enablement, improving the customer experience, and/or improving the product

Compensation

💸 We pay you an above-average salary because we want to hire the best people who are fully focused on helping Sourcegraph succeed, not worried about paying bills. You will have the flexibility to work and live anywhere in the world (unless specified otherwise in the job description), and we’ll never take your location or current/past salary information into account when determining your compensation.  As an open and transparent company that values equitable and competitive compensation for everyone, our compensation ranges are visible to every single Sourcegraph Teammate. To determine your salary, we use a number of market and data-driven salary sources and target the high-end of the range, ensuring that we’re always paying above market regardless of where you live in the world.  

💰 The compensation for this role is $42,400 USD base.

📈 In addition to our cash compensation, we offer equity (because when we succeed as a company, we want you to succeed, too) and generous perks & benefits.


Interview process 

👋 Introduction Stage - we have initial conversations to get to know you better…

  • [30 min] Recruiter Screen 
  • [45 min] Hiring Manager screen / Resume Deep Dive

🧑‍💻 Team Interview Stage - we then delve into your experience in more depth and introduce you to members of the team…

  • [Async 1.5 hr] You complete a technical project and we share the results over email.
  • [60 min] Technical knowledge/troubleshooting + collaboration/communication skills with an existing member of our Support Engineering team.  

🎉 Final Interview Stage - we move you to our final round, where you meet cross-functional partners and gain a better understanding of our business and values holistically…

  • [30 min] Values interview
  • [15 min] Leadership 
  • We check references and conduct your background check

Please note - you are welcome to request additional conversations with anyone you would like to meet, but didn’t get to meet during the interview process.

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
